The Ohio State men's basketball team saw its 2024-25 season come to a disappointing end with two straight losses, and a 2-5 record in their final seven games to narrowly miss the NCAA Tournament. Now, Jake Diebler is working to not only keep the core of his team together, with Bruce Thornton, John Mobley, and Devin Royal all planning to return, and Christoph Tilly and Gabe Cupps added in the Transfer Portal, what else do the Buckeyes need to do in order to get back to the Big Dance next season?Tony Gerdeman of BuckeyeHuddle.com joins host Tom Orr to discuss that and more on this episode of the Buckeyes TomOrrow Morning podcast.

The Assembly Call IU Basketball Podcast and Postgame Show

On Tuesday, Indiana gritted out a 74-68 win over Iowa, despite blowing a 17-point first-half lead and losing Xavier Johnson and Malik Reneau to injury. Anthony Leal had the best game of his IU career scoring 13 points off the bench while Kel'el Ware led the team with 23 points.IU took the lead for good at 69-68 on a Gabe Cupps three-pointer in the final two minutes. This was after Iowa's Payton Sandfort gave the Hawkeyes the advantage on a ridiculous fade away jumper in the corner as the shot clock was expiring. The Hoosiers improved to 13-8 overall and 5-5 in the league and take on Penn State Saturday at 12 pm on FS1. The Hoosiers score a big one! Join Mike Goodpaster, Steve Risley and Brian Mohr as they discuss the Hoosiers' newest addition Mackenzie Mgbako! The Hoosiers look like a Top ten team now headed into the 2023-24 season!Mackenzie Mgbako from Roselle Catholic (New Jersey) signed his letter of intent with Indiana on Friday evening. Mgbako initially committed to Duke in October before opening up his recruitment in April and visiting St. John's, Kansas and Indiana before selecting Indiana as his destination. Mgbako considered Louisville but decided against visiting. According to 247 Composite, this 6-foot-8 forward is currently ranked as the No. 8 player in the 2023 class.He became the highest-ranked high school recruit to commit under Mike Woodson, now in his third season in Bloomington.According to RSCI rankings, Indiana has only attracted top-10 recruits since 1998: Eric Gordon, Romeo Langford, Noah Vonleh, Jared Jeffries and Cody Zeller are the only five. Mgbako joins Gabe Cupps and Jakai Newton as three high school players that will join Indiana for the 2023-24 season. Indiana also recently welcomed three transfers - Kel'el Ware from Oregon, Anthony Walker from Miami and Payton Sparks from Ball State - as part of its 2023-24 roster.Do the Hoosiers now have a roster that can bring Indiana back to national relevance? Only time will tell, but Cosck Woodson is doing a great job of stacking the Hoosiers roster with talented and athletic players.Indiana looks on paper at least as a top ten contender to win a National Championship in the upcoming season; the Hoosier's last National Championship was in 1987, and the teams last Final Four appearance was in 2002 so Coach Woodson has his work cut out for him. *Like, subscribe, comment, and follow us on social media!*Four-star point guard Gabe Cupps committed to Mike Woodson and the Hoosiers on Tuesday evening. Cupps comes out of Centerville High School near Dayton, Ohio and chose the Hoosiers over Ohio State and Stanford.What will Cupps bring to the table when he steps on the Assembly Hall floor in a couple years? Which players do the guys compare him to in order to get a better feel for his game?Also, the 2-0 Hoosiers whacked Northern Illinois and now face a critical test against Big East challenger St. John's. What are the key matchups that Indiana needs to win to stay undefeated?
